Full title: The history of female favourites: of Mary de Padilla, under Peter the Cruel, King of Castile; Livia, under the Emperor Augustus; Julia Farnesa, under Pope Alexander the Sixth; Agnes Soreau, under Charles Vii. King of France; and Nantilda, under Dagobert, King of France.

Creator

La Roche-Guilhem, Anne de, 1644-1707.

Publisher

London, printed for C. Parker, the Upper End of New Bond-Street

Date

M.DCC.LXXII. [1772]

Format

[4], 324p. ; 21 cm (8⁰).

Description

Selected and translated from 'Histoire des favorites' by Anne de la Roche-Guihen.

Contents: Mary de Padilla -- Livia -- Julia Farneas -- Agnus Sorezu -- Nantilda.

Binding: contemporary mottled calf with morocco and gilt to spine; marbled endpapers.
